Possible help for connective tissue repair due to fluoroquinolone induced injury
I bought this for my husband. He was on an antibiotic and suffered a serious side effect. Cipro and other antibiotics in the fluoroquinolone category carry a "Black Box" warning about the damage they can cause to tendons and other connective tissues. My husband suffered bi-lateral Achilles tendon damage and damage to the articular cartilage in his ankles, along with tendon pain in his wrists. He was not able to walk for four and a half months. Numerous doctor visits to many specialists have not helped.My field is nutrition, so as soon as he developed pain in his Achilles tendons, I began doing intensive reading on "fluroquinoline induced injury." I started him on a rigorous supplement program to try to rebuild healthy tendon cells and cartilage. This product was one of things I included in his supplement routine to support connective tissue repair.We do believe this product has helped. Over the past year, from time to time I will stop including this in with his supplements without telling him ("blind experiment") and after a week or two, he always tells me his pain has increased again. I add this product back into his supplements (without his knowledge) and in a few days, he tells me he feels better.From the extensive research I have done, I've learned that fluoroquinoline induced injury actually damages the rNA in the tendons, so it is no longer able to replicate healthy tenocytes (tendon cells). Because of that, we have no idea if this problem will ever be truly resolved. But, meantime, this product does seem to help reduce his pain level that comes from the damaged connective tissues.Please understand that we are using this along with an entire arsenal of other nutritional products. Any time I try eliminating any of them, his pain increases again. So, I can't say this product alone would have helped him - but, I can say we do believe it has made a difference when we use it in conjunction with other products that support connective tissue repair. And the reason I feel comfortable with that conclusion is because of what I stated above - that if I secretly stop giving this to him, his pain increases, and when I secretly add it back in, his pain level decreases.

These Little Gems are Great!
My knee joints are a little over 55 years old. For fitness (or recreation?) I run about 4 miles 4 times per week. Plus one evening of beach volleyball, one evening of indoor volleyball and two afternoons of Ultimate Disc every week. I had periodic knee joint aches that started about 7 years ago. Six years ago I had both knee joints checked out by a sports doctor and I agreed to Hyaluronic (Synvisc) injections directly into the knee joint area. These were costly, but mostly covered by health insurance. The injections worked great for me. However, after 4-5 years the knee aches slowly returned. I was faced with either eliminating some of my recreational activities or spending big bucks for another round of injections (since reasonable health insurance coverage/costs deteriorated quicker than my joints). I researched the benefits and options of less costly alternatives and came across Hyaluronic Acid supplements. I was highly skeptical, but decided to give it a try. I'm a once-a-day supplement-taker (evening after dinner), so I decided to cut the daily dosage in half. Before I emptied my first container of these little gems, my knee aches were already gone. I'm thinking ok, placebo effect right? Well its now been over 90 days, and still no sign of any knee joint aches. I'm also eating a banana almost every day since I learned they too are high in natural Hyaluronic acid. Plus I'm also making sure I get plenty of vitamin C to break the acid down into the components your body can use for joint lubrication/moisture retention. For complete and honest disclosure, I have two other friends (volleyball players), taking the exact same supplement and they are not seeing the same benefits as me.
